About Elverado Intermediate School

Elverado Intermediate School is a public elementary school in Vergennes, IL, part of Elverado CUSD 196. Elverado Intermediate School serves approximately 73 students, and covers grades 3rd-5th, and has a 10.4:1 student-teacher ratio. Elverado Intermediate School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 6.9 out of 10 and ranks #1,307 of 3,813 schools in IL.

Structured state assessment records for Elverado Intermediate School show 41%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2021) and 36%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022).

What Parents Should Know

At 73 students, Elverado Intermediate School is on the smaller side. That usually buys more individual attention and teachers who know every kid by name, with the trade-off of fewer electives and extracurriculars than a larger school can staff. Ask what activities it actually offers.

Elverado Intermediate School sits in a rural area, which can mean longer drives for some families. Rural schools are often community anchors with smaller classes, but check transportation, after-school options, and access to specialized services before you commit.
